[mvapich-discuss] MVAPICH2 2.1a, PMI2 interface, SLURM srun parallel luncher

Jonathan Perkins perkinjo at cse.ohio-state.edu
Thu Oct 16 12:40:45 EDT 2014


On Thu, Oct 16, 2014 at 05:18:01PM +0100, Filippo Spiga wrote:
> Hi Jonathan,
> 
> On Oct 16, 2014, at 2:39 PM, Jonathan Perkins <perkinjo at cse.ohio-state.edu> wrote:
> > Can you try just using --with-pm=hydra (still keep using
> > --with-pmi=pmi2)?  I haven't tried this in a while but I know that early
> > in the process I experimented with this and we where in fact able to
> > still run slurm jobs since both slurm and hydra support pmi2.
> 
> It does not work. The configure complains if I do the following
> "--with-pm=hydra --with-pmi=pmi2"
> 
> configure: error: The PM chosen (hydra) requires the PMI
> implementation simple but pmi2 was selected as the PMI implementation. 
> 
> If I leave only "--with-pm=hydra" without PMI, then srun do not lunch
> the executable compiled against MVAPICH2 properly. 
> 
> I am afraid I need to keep two builds, one SLURM-aware and
> PMI2-compatible and one "standard"

Okay, We'll see if we can remove this requirement in the future.

-- 
Jonathan Perkins


More information about the mvapich-discuss mailing list